5 people burnt to death in Ctg

Sun News Desk: At least 5 people were burnt to death in a fire in their house in Rangunia upazila of Chattogram on Friday.

The deceased were identified as Kangal Boshak, 68, Lolita Boshak, 57, Lucky Boshak, 33, Shayanti Boshak, 6, and Sowrabh Boshak, 12.

Another member of the family, Khokon Boshak, 42, was rushed to Chittagong Medical College Hospital in a critical condition.

Agrabad Fire Service and Civil Defence deputy assistant director Abdul Hamid Mia confirmed the incident.

He said that firefighters reached the spot after getting the information and they could tame the flames around 4am.

Abu Bakar, sub-inspector of Rangunia police station, said the bodies of five members of the family were brought to the police station in the morning.
